      That sounds like a false awakening. Many people think of inception when they realize they had a "dream within a dream" but they're not uncommon and are a good way to get you lucid. You just have to be sure to preform a RC every time you wake up.

      Quote Originally Posted by TheGritz View Post
      Are all people prone to have false awakenings? I can vaguely remember having maybe one since I have started LDing. (It's been a few months now.) They just aren't that common for me.
      Yes, all people can have them but they are more common for others. Don't forget that you also don't remember all your dreams each night so it's a high possibility that you forget any you do have.
